Hope someone can help. Ive just created my forum for my website and all seems well enough but it doesnt seem to want to update any information? Ive changed the time and that seems to have stayed the same and also i got an email to say someone had registered but this doesnt seem to have updated either? Is there something i have forgotten to do (likely option !) or is there a significant time delay?

As long as newly registered users have not activated their account by clicking in the activation key in the e-mail they receive, they will appear only in Admin Panel > User Admin > Inactive users.

Non-activated users don't appear in the memberlist because we had much abuse by spammers who put online pharmacy or porn links in their profiles.
